From 61e330e70da4087f8616fded0842419976e0abb9 Mon Sep 17 00:00:00 2001 From: Horilla Date: Wed, 3 Sep 2025 11:00:55 +0530 Subject: [PATCH] [FIX] EMPLOYEE: Note length issue --- employee/models.py | 4 +--- employee/templates/tabs/add_note.html | 34 ++++++++++++++++++--------- employee/templates/tabs/note_tab.html | 2 +- 3 files changed, 25 insertions(+), 15 deletions(-) diff --git a/employee/models.py b/employee/models.py index 3a43dc94d..b494b2ce5 100644 --- a/employee/models.py +++ b/employee/models.py @@ -976,9 +976,7 @@ class EmployeeNote(HorillaModel): on_delete=models.CASCADE, related_name="employee_name", ) - description = models.TextField( - verbose_name=_("Description"), max_length=255, null=True - ) + description = models.TextField(verbose_name=_("Description"), null=True) # 905 note_files = models.ManyToManyField(NoteFiles, blank=True) updated_by = models.ForeignKey(Employee, on_delete=models.CASCADE) objects = HorillaCompanyManager( diff --git a/employee/templates/tabs/add_note.html b/employee/templates/tabs/add_note.html index 40944d196..73bf017fa 100644 --- a/employee/templates/tabs/add_note.html +++ b/employee/templates/tabs/add_note.html @@ -1,13 +1,25 @@ {% load i18n %} -
- {{note_form.as_p}} -
- -
+{% load basefilters %} + + + {% csrf_token %} +
+
+ {{employee}}'s {% trans "Notes" %} + {% if perms.employee.add_employeenote or request.user|is_reportingmanager %} + {% if form.description.errors %} + {{ form.description.errors }} + {% endif %} + + {% endif %} +
+ +
+
diff --git a/employee/templates/tabs/note_tab.html b/employee/templates/tabs/note_tab.html index 4be186cc2..406ca09b6 100644 --- a/employee/templates/tabs/note_tab.html +++ b/employee/templates/tabs/note_tab.html @@ -136,7 +136,7 @@ {% else %}
+ id="commentForm"> {% csrf_token %}